If you have been coming to visit under the old Southern ooaks tree then you know that I'm currently working on some Christmas glass ornaments using some of my doodles as the designs. WOW...it does take some time to work with glass and acrylics as you have to let each layer dry completely before adding the next. Sooo, I'm doing something I don't normally do. I'm working on several at one time. Now...if my muse will just help me NOT get any of the designs mixed up we'll be good.

Here's the ones I have completed so far. Remember that these are doodles and follow along kind of a primitive cave man's drawings.







Each one has sand from Gulf Shores and tiny shells I found there as well. Before anyone thinks to report me to the sand police, I didn't go and dig up sand and bring it home. HeHe  This is sand that I have been collecting for several years from the shells I bring home and clean. You'd be amazed at the amount of sand in a shell, especially the olive shells.
